Dallas Wholesale Distribution Adds Versetta Stone to Product Offering

The distributor will offer the full lineup of stone siding from its three Texas and Oklahoma locations.

Dallas Wholesale Distribution is adding Versetta Stone siding to its product offering. Versetta Stone siding panels, manufactured by Boral Building Products, provides the texture of authentic stone masonry in a panelized, mortarless format that can be installed easily, according to the manufacturer.

“We’re always looking for products that align with our customer base. Stone is a common cladding material in our markets; however, most of our customers don’t service the masonry business, so we didn’t have a great option for them,” Matt Ellis, vice president of talent management and marketing at Dallas Wholesale Distribution, said in a news release. “When we reviewed Boral Building Products’ Versetta Stone offering, we knew it made a lot of sense. It appeals to the dealer because they already sell siding—it’s a great add-on. For the builder, it offers both easy installation and a great look to boost their brand.”

Dallas Wholesale Distribution will offer the full lineup of Versetta Stone, including the Tight-Cut, Ledgestone, and Carved Block profiles and all colors of the product. Its three locations, Austin, Dallas, and Oklahoma City, serve most of Texas and Oklahoma, as well as parts of Louisiana, Arkansas, and New Mexico.

“As a specialty products distributor in Texas and Oklahoma, Dallas Wholesale is known for providing a lot of value and having great relationships,” said Austin Crawford, director of sales – west for Boral Building Products. “We are excited to have them as the newest Versetta Stone distributor and are looking forward to working closely with them to develop the markets they serve.”

Established in 1955, Dallas Wholesale Distribution is a family-owned, two-step wholesale distributor of building materials and millwork products. The company’s operations include a millwork distribution center in DeSoto, Texas, and building material branches in DeSoto, Texas, and Round Rock, Texas, with offerings including roofing, siding, dimension lumber, engineered wood, sheathing, insulation, and housewrap. The Boral Building Products division comprises 11 brands and the company is a division of Boral North America.
